Kwara Boxers Eager for National Sports Festival as Mega Bouts ends in Ilorin

Date: 2021-01-03

Kwara State Amateur Boxing Association under the leadership of Barrister Ahmed Musa Rufai is poised to change the concept of the ring based sports from passion to profession while identifying talents that will haul laurels in National and International competitions.

Speaking during the Kwara Mega Boxing Bouts 2021 tagged "Another A for AA" which held on January 1st, 2021 at the Indoor Sports Hall of Kwara State Stadium, the Chairman of Boxing Association, Ahmed said the only way to remove crime tendencies from young ones is to engage them in sporting activities.

The one-day event provided Boxing prodigies from Oyo, Osun, and the host State opportunities to sharpen their skills towards conquering the stage at the upcoming Edo National Sports festival slated for February 14th to 28th, 2021.

Exhibition duels between Kali Okanlawon and Yusuf Suleiman with another one involving Okanlawon Lateef of Kwara State and Oluwa Damilare of Oyo State heralded bouts of different categories to complement the euphoria of the new year day.

In all the 10 major encounters, punches dragged boxers around the ring with artistry telling a lot of the potentials the sports can boast of in the country.

In the 43kg main bout, Musa Taofeeq of Kwara defeated Adeniran Fawas from Oyo State to secure the first gold for the host State with the 52kg category clash between Ahmed Suleiman of Kwara and Sodiq Abdulrahman (Oyo State) again also producing another gold for the Harmony State.

Liadi Azeez (Kwara) in the 56kg conquered Semiu Olamoyero Adetunji (Osun) while Abdulganiy Yinus also outsmarted his Kwara fellow, Kaleeb Israel in the 60kg category of the fight.

Saheed Jamiu added to the gold medals of Kwara after out-punching Rasheed Ahmed of Oyo State in the 64kg.

In another set of 64kg, Olanrewaju Suleiman of Kwara fell to Oladiti Abdullahi of Oyo as the duel between Jimoh Ismaila (Kwara) and Rufai Ibrahim Dare (Osun) handed the former a gold medal in the 69kg placed combat.

The 75kg class was another battle of Kwarans that produced Shuaib Yakub Omotosho as the winner against Ogundokun Sodiq while the highest placed battle of the day- 81kg between Abdullahi Ibrahim of Kwara and Hammed Adekunle from Oyo State ended in favour of the Kwara boxer.

The only female bouts had Tijani Fausiyat of Kwara State and Lateef Sofiat from Lagos State sharing the ring- the latter eventually emerged winner after the blockbuster.

In total,Kwara State led the packs by hauling 8 Gold and 4 Silver medals. Oyo State secured 1 Gold and 4 Silver medals while Lagos State and Osun State went home with 1 Gold and 2 Silver medals respectively.
